How unhealthy is a turkey burger?
A 4-ounce cooked turkey burger (made from a combo of dark and light meat) has 193 calories, 11 grams of fat, 3 grams of saturated fat and 22 grams of protein. It's an excellent source of niacin and selenium and a good source of vitamin B6, phosphorus and zinc.Is turkey or beef better for you?

Any meat that has been cured, smoked, canned or salted is a processed food, and these types of meats, including hot dogs, salami and cured bacon, are associated with increased risk of conditions such as heart disease, high blood pressure, and certain cancers such as bowel or stomach.Is a turkey burger or chicken breast healthier?

How many calories in a turkey burger compared to a beef burger?
According to the USDA, a 3-ounce patty made of 80 percent lean beef provides 209 calories. A 93 percent lean patty of the same size provides 164 calories. A 3-ounce ground turkey patty provides 173 calories, while the fat-free version clocks in at only 117 calories.
